The Bubble Review: Netflix’s Comedy Movie From Judd Apatow 2022

 

The Bubble, directed by Judd Apatow and shot at Shepperton Studios, satirises this well-known event with a lighthearted approach. “The Bubble,” which is structured in loosely connected episodes (where entire sub-plots might be eliminated without affecting the overall), is often incredibly humorous, although there are sections where it lags or flounders at just over two hours. Faster (and shorter) is usually funnier with content like this.

The Bubble is a comedy film directed by Judd Apatow in 2022, based on a script co-written by Pam Brady.  Netflix’s The Bubble premiered on April 1, 2022, and got mixed reviews from critics.

The Bubble Stream on the Netflix

On April 1, 2022, Apatow’s first film for Netflix, The Bubble, will be released on the streaming site. On March 25, 2022, the film was also distributed in select theatres.

The genuine challenges and tribulations that the Jurassic World: Dominion actors and crew faced during the film’s 2020 production inspired the concept of a comedy about producing an action movie during the pandemic.

For the most part, The Bubble is undirected. In the grand scheme of things, ‘Cliff Beasts 6’ has no relevance. Apatow’s strategy of using the pandemic to highlight the hardships of interminable quarantines, intrusive diagnostic testing, and severe social isolation works well at first.

However, as Apatow runs out of material, the early promise begins to fade. The picture deteriorates to the point when one of the cast members, Howie Frangapolous (Guz Khan), practically flees the set.

The writers appeared to be utterly lacking in inspiration. Only a few flashes of brilliance remain, buried behind the immense strain of carrying the weight of an unimaginative plot and premise.

The Bubble Cast

The Bubble

  • Carol Cobb, a washed-up actress who plays Dr. Lacey Nightingale in the Cliff Beasts franchise, is played by Karen Gillan.
  • Krystal Kris, a TikTok sensation who joins the Cliff Beasts 6 ensemble as Vivian Joy, is played by Iris Apatow.
  • Pedro Pascal stars as Dieter Bravo, a serious professional actor who plays a new character named Gio in Cliff Beasts 6 while battling a sex and heavy drug addiction.
  • Lauren Van Chance is played by Leslie Mann, an actress who plays Dolly, a Cliff Beasts fan favourite and Dustin’s on-again, off-again love interest.
  • Darren Eigan, a former independent filmmaker hired to direct Cliff Beasts 6, is played by Fred Armisen.
  • Dustin Mulray, the workaholic lead of the Cliff Beasts franchise who plays Dr. Hal Packard and Lauren’s on-again, off-again love interest, is played by David Duchovny.
  • Sean Knox, played by Keegan-Michael Key, is an actor who plays Colt Rockwell in the Cliff Beasts series and presents himself as a wellness expert when he’s not on filming.
  • Paula, the studio executive in charge of the Cliff Beasts series, is played by Kate McKinnon.
  • Guz Khan stars as Howie Frangopolous, the actor who plays Jarrar, the Cliff Beasts’ comic relief character.
  • Gavin, executive producer of the Cliff Beasts franchise, is played by Peter Serafinowicz.
  • Krystal’s mother is played by Maria Bamford.
